[framework-issues] [Issue 113568] Silent corruption of user dictionaries
To comment on the following update, log in, then open the issue: http://www.openoffice.org/issues/show_bug.cgi?id=113568 Issue #|113568 Summary|Silent corruption of user dictionaries Component|framework Version|DEV300m84 Platform|PC URL| OS/Version|All Status|UNCONFIRMED Status whiteboard| Keywords| Resolution| Issue type|DEFECT Priority|P3 Subcomponent|code Assigned to|tm Reported by|jurf --- Additional comments from j...@openoffice.org Sun Aug 1 07:43:05 + 2010 --- OOo-dev330m85 and probably OOO330m2 may corrupt .dic user dictionaries when user adds words. Buggy behaviour is not present in 3.2.1, hence regression. DESCRIPTION When adding words to a user dictionary (right-click menu), one of four things may happen: 1. word is added normally, speller behaves as expected; 2. word is added to *another* user dictionary (not the one selected, and not necessarily active); 3. only part of the word is added, appended at the end of the .dic (tested on UTF8-versioned dic files); 4. word is not added at all, but part of the last word in a .dic (not necessarily the one selected) is repeated as the new last entry. The buggy behaviour was first noticed on an updated install (using settings, including user dictionaries, created in older versions of OOo), but also occurred on a clean installation with default user settings. In that case, words I'd supposedly added to standard.dic were actually added to the ignore list. Having seen similar bugs in a variety of programs (garbage appearing at the end of incorrectly processed files, paragraphs or text selections, or even in other non-selected paragraphs or files), I'd guess the problem is caused by a text/bound parser that isn't counting straight when it encounters anything other than single-byte characters, which in turn causes miscalculated insert positions and data corruption while sorting fields etc. I'm quite confident about this guess as the same build I was testing (OOo-dev330m85) also has data-corrupting flaws in its new text-casing options, which also relies on calculating text bounds - see Issue 113558. For the user dictionary routine, I noticed the problem surfaced when multi-byte characters (such as a letter with unusual accents, for which there are no precomposed versions in Unicode) were present, either in the word being added, or - fatally - already included in a user dictionary (not necessarily the one selected to receive the word). [api-issues] [Issue 113171] OO does not paste the tex t contents of the Windows clipboard - instead, it pastes the previous text copied in OO
To comment on the following update, log in, then open the issue: http://www.openoffice.org/issues/show_bug.cgi?id=113171 --- Additional comments from john...@openoffice.org Sun Aug 1 10:28:12 + 2010 --- OO has a long delay (several seconds) before copied text is placed on the Windows Clipboard. When I copy some text from any other application, the contents of the Windows Clipboard are immediately cleared and the copied text immediately appears in the Clipboard. But when I copy some text (ctrl/c or Edit Copy) from an OO document, while the Clipboard is immediately cleared, the copied text does not appear in the Clipboard until several seconds later. During the period that the Clipboard is empty, if I paste into any other application, nothing is pasted (correct - the Clipboard is empty). BUT if I paste into any OO document while the Clipboard is empty, the copied text is pasted. So, OO appears to be holding the copied text in an internal buffer and OO is not pasting it to the Windows Clipboard until a delay of several seconds. This internal buffer may be the reason for the behaviour reported in this bug report, namely OO does not paste the text contents of the Windows clipboard - instead, it pastes the previous text copied in OO I am now running OOO320m18 Build:9502 - Please do not reply to this automatically generated notification from Issue Tracker. [api-issues] [Issue 113171] OO does not paste the tex t contents of the Windows clipboard - instead, it pastes the previous text copied in OO
To comment on the following update, log in, then open the issue: http://www.openoffice.org/issues/show_bug.cgi?id=113171 --- Additional comments from john...@openoffice.org Sun Aug 1 10:45:55 + 2010 --- I am checking the Clipboard using MS Clipboard Viewer clipbrd.exe. The delay only occurs if clipbrd.exe is started before OO. If OO is started before clipbrd.exe, the delay does not occur. Please note that the original problem of OO pasting the previous contents occurs when clipbrd.exe is not running. I only use clipbrd.exe to assist debugging. This delay with Clipboard viewers appears to be well known. Searching on 'copy paste delay' finds a number of issues including 49907. Note that the user does not need to be running a Clipboard viewer to experience the delays because some applications apparently silently monitor the Clipboard without telling the user (by calls the MS API function called SetClipboardViewer().) - Please do not reply to this automatically generated notification from Issue Tracker. [graphics-issues] [Issue 113572] for B-splines Data point s order=2 is not saved to file
To comment on the following update, log in, then open the issue: http://www.openoffice.org/issues/show_bug.cgi?id=113572 Issue #|113572 Summary|for B-splines Data points order=2 is not saved to fi |le Component|Chart Version|DEV300m84 Platform|PC URL| OS/Version|Windows XP Status|UNCONFIRMED Status whiteboard| Keywords| Resolution| Issue type|DEFECT Priority|P3 Subcomponent|save-export Assigned to|kla Reported by|regina --- Additional comments from reg...@openoffice.org Sun Aug 1 19:37:23 + 2010 --- Take a new spreadsheat. Delete Sheet2 and Sheet2 to get smaller file. Switch of size optimization for ODF format to get better readable file. Enter some pairs of x|y values for example x y 0 -1 1 1 2 -1 3 1 4 -1 5 1 Generate an XY-Chart with smooth linespoints using B-Spline with Resolution=5 and Data points order=2. Notice, that the curve goes approimately through (3|0.5) Save the file. Reload the file and double click the chart to actualize the preview. Notice that the curve now goes through (3|0.2). Do not save. Unpack the file and look into the content.xml of the chart object. The attribute chart:spline-order is missing in style:chart-properties If you use another value for data points order, then the attribute is saved as expected. - Please do not reply to this automatically generated notification from Issue Tracker.
